Take care when utilizing energy tools. If you're new to woodworking, be very cautious when you are operating power tools for the primary time. Read the manual thoroughly, and if potential, have somebody with expertise exhibit how to use it properly. This may make sure that you do not have a nasty accident throughout your woodworking undertaking.
Use stop blocks to your benefit for extra accurate work. When reducing loads of items the same size, regardless of how carefully you measure, you often discover small variations. Use a pre-lower stop block to make these measurements pinpoint correct. Then the table noticed will cease at just the best size length.

Make sure your workbench is the right top. It actually can make a big distinction. It needs to fit you and how you're employed. Normally in case you are around 5'6" to 5'9" you in all probability need one that is between 33" and 36" high. If you're 5'10" or taller, you might have one that is between 35" and 37" excessive. Use your bench at its current height to determine if you happen to need to vary it to work higher for you.
By no means permit somebody to watch while you are woodworking without sporting the same gear that you're wearing. Being anyplace close to the tools is a hazard, even when they are not utilizing them. Wooden or parts of the software could fly into the air and strike them just as they could you.

There are some fundamental instruments needed for woodworking tasks. These include a noticed, hammer, information, degree, square and measuring tapes. Larger items of gear you may have are various kinds of electrical powered saws and sanders. The facility instruments might be fairly expensive, and you might not want them except you do loads of woodworking initiatives.
You need to use woodworkers glue to safe joints if you happen to clamp the joint securely in place while the glue dries. Many people choose to glue the joint in addition to utilizing fasteners. This prevents the joint from loosening if it is subjected to pressure that would trigger it to offer way.
Go to the artwork provide retailer and get a drafting sq.. Carpenter squares are a problem, and drywall squares are notoriously inaccurate. Once you need a precise sq. a number of ft in width and length, a drafting sq. is a surefire winner. As soon as you use it just a few instances, you may probably use it simply as a lot as a tape measure.
